''Jay Hanuman,'' notches further due to an extremely upbeat orchestration and a velvety vocalization by Shankar Mahadevan and Kailash Kher. The track scores high on inspiring lyrics set on an uncomplicated tune.
Some divine fun and frolic gets underway with ''Akdam Bakdam'' that is rendered by Shravan, the kiddo who sounds absolutely cute. Unlike the previous two, this one is different thanks to the verve and velocity, such that the track races through your senses, escalating the kid's celestial rapping.
''Destroying The Ashok Vatika'' and ''Bridge Across the Ocean,'' both rendered by Vijay Prakash, compliment the overall tempo of this daringly different compilation.
Side B of the tape, opens with ''Hanuman Chalisa'' tunefully recited by singers Vijay Prakash, Nandini and Rashmi followed by brisk instrumentals in ''The War Begins,'' and ''Kumbhkaran.''
The compilation comes to a quick conclusion with dubbed voice of Rajesh Jolly in ''Ravan Goes to War'' and a complete fulfilling track, ''Jay Bajrangbali'' that has Palash and Kinshuk Sen swathed in blissful harmonies.
Obviously, there is not much commercial element associated with the music of Hanuman that thrives on its devotional appeal and a huge celebrity singer prop up.
